Q3 Planning Note — Sales Leads

Effective next quarter, discounts on deals above 200 seats for the Vantrell Suite require sign-off from Dalia Rook before quoting. Standard tiers stay capped at 12%; anything beyond goes through deal desk review with a margin justification. Track exceptions in the pipeline sheet weekly. The context for this tightening is summarized in the note below.

board note of kageg-bahof: The renewal with Holwynax Holdings closes at $2 million a year, 5 percent below the last contract. Project Ulaath slips by two quarters because of the supplier delay.

PROPS RUN — "The Lantern Revels" TOUR, LEG 3

Heads up: the big crate with the clockwork moon and the two breakaway thrones travels separate from the main truck this leg. Bramblehurst Haulage is doing the run from the Ostwick depot to the Ferndale Playhouse, Thursday overnight. Tell your driver the crate is top-heavy — straps, not just chocks. Load-in window at Ferndale is 06:00–07:30, stage door side. Venue crew meets them there. The Ferndale crew will only take the crate off our driver against the phrase below.

handover note for yagef-bagep: the drudor pelius courier leaves the kasdor zorvan norir ledger at gate 8016 under passcode 755406

Subject: Handover — Brightgate consent banner rollout

Team,

Taking over from me on the Brightgate consent banner. Phase 2 ships Thursday: regions Veldmark and Ostany get the new opt-out flow. Flags live in the Lanternly console under `consent-v2`. Rollback is flag-off plus cache purge, nothing fancy. QA sign-off is already logged. Release bundles must be signed before the CDN push; verifier runs in the pipeline automatically. Sign the bundle with the release key below.

rollout seal: bky9_aBG1gvAyU

# Idempotency keys for payment retries (support reference)
#
# Every retry of a charge through LedgerBridge must reuse the original
# idempotency key, otherwise the customer can be double-billed. The key
# is derived from the order ID plus attempt window, so manual retries
# from the support console are safe as long as you do not edit the
# order ID field. This client authenticates against the internal
# LedgerBridge gateway. The service key used for that call follows.

gateway credential: kto23_LX9A4ys6i4nzHtpOLNLodKK